About Bowser Courtesy Listing
Start your journey together! Apply now. Bowser is an energetic, big-hearted Boxer/Pit Bull mix who is looking for an equally active home to match his zest for life. At just 2 years old and weighing about 70 pounds, he is full of love, intelligence, and personality. With his boundless energy and affectionate nature, Bowser absolutely adores children, though supervision is suggested for younger kids due to his strength and exuberance. He gets along with some other dogs, but his ideal home would let him be the star as an only dog where he can soak up all the attention. Known for thinking he’s a lap dog, Bowser will happily snuggle up and fill your days with laughter thanks to his vocal 'talk-back' personality. Bowser already has several commands under his belt and is fully house-trained, comfortable in his crate, and sleeps soundly in one each night. He is always ready for adventure, with running, chasing balls, and tug-of-war all on his list of favorite activities. Bowser will thrive in a home that can provide ample exercise, attention, and structure. He would especially shine with an energetic older child or teen to run and play with. What type of living environment is this breed usually best suited for?
Boxer/Pit Bull mixes generally thrive in spacious homes where they can have room to play and burn energy. They do well in active households capable of providing daily exercise and mental stimulation.
How much outdoor space does this breed typically need?
This mix does best with access to a secure yard or nearby parks for regular exercise. Frequent walks and opportunities to run are important for their physical and mental well-being.
Is this breed typically suitable for homes with children?
Boxer and Pit Bull mixes are often very affectionate and playful with children. With proper supervision and training, they can be wonderful family companions.
